CII AP hosts Global Market Access Summit

Published on

CII Andhra Pradesh recently organized a Summit on Global Market Access with its theme “Building Stronger Andhra Pradesh: Fostering Growth & Global Linkages” recently in the city of Visakhapatnam.

The summit featured a distinguished lineup of speakers and experts in the field, aimed at enhancing understanding and compliance with statutory requirements.

The confederation of Indian industry business session focused on Enhancing Bilateral Trade: Andhra Pradesh’s Role in Global Economic Integration.

Dr. V Murali Krishna, Chairman, CII Andhra Pradesh emphasized the need to understand the export and import compliances while building a sustainable enterprise.

Mr. CMA Kalla Gowtham, CEO – World Trade Centre Andhra Pradesh Medtech Zone (WTC AMTZ) spoke on the export scenario of AP and introduced AMTZ ecosystem and support toward the industry.

Mr. Abhijit Shinde, Founder & CEO, of Impex Federation set the tone of the summit by underscoring the significance of the exports & imports process and highlighting the challenges faced by the industry.

Similarly other sessions highlighted sustainable export practices, and regulatory compliance to overcome trade barriers in global markets & Leveraging Indian Exim Bank for export business in Andhra Pradesh.
